WebOct 17, 2024 · Which has a larger atomic radius sodium or lithium? a. Sodium has a greater atomic radius because it is in period 3 and thus has 3 energy levels (while lithium is in period 2 and only has 2 energy levels). WebJan 30, 2024 · Lithium's outer electron is in the second level, and only has the 1s 2 electrons to screen it. The 2s 1 electron feels the pull of 3 protons screened by 2 electrons - a net pull from the center of 1+. The sodium's outer electron is in the third level, and is screened from the 11 protons in the nucleus by a total of 10 inner electrons.
